Arsenal Fans Fume as Referee’s Controversial Decision Denies Penalty
Last weekend’s Premier League match between Arsenal and Newcastle United at St. James’ Park was marked by a controversial incident involving referee Jarred Gillett, who broke PGMOL protocol in the process of denying the Gunners a penalty. Despite Arsenal ultimately securing a 2-1 victory with late goals from Mikel Merino and Gabriel Magalhaes, fans were left fuming over the referee’s decision.
The Incident
In the 14th minute of the match, it appeared that Arsenal had been awarded a penalty after Nick Pope was deemed to have fouled Viktor Gyokeres in the box. However, to the surprise and dismay of Arsenal players and fans alike, referee Gillett overturned his decision and denied the penalty, much to the disbelief of onlookers.
The decision sparked outrage among Arsenal supporters, who felt that the referee’s reversal was unjust and potentially influenced the outcome of the game. Many fans took to social media to express their frustration and disbelief at the turn of events.
